How to automate IT infrastructure management efficiently. You'll gain skills in deploying, managing, and orchestrating various applications and systems across multiple environments. The course will cover essential topics like playbooks, modules, roles, and inventory management, enabling you to configure systems, deploy applications, and perform tasks using Ansible's simple yet powerful automation language. You'll also understand how to manage configurations, handle complex deployments, and maintain consistent environments, which are crucial for improving operational efficiency and reliability in IT infrastructure.
To learn Ansible, you need a basic understanding of system administration, familiarity with command-line interfaces, and knowledge of YAML syntax.
Audience
Learning Ansible offers numerous benefits, including streamlined and automated IT infrastructure management, which reduces manual intervention and minimizes errors. It enhances efficiency by allowing you to deploy applications, manage configurations, and orchestrate complex tasks across multiple systems effortlessly. Ansible's simplicity and agentless architecture make it easy to learn and implement, saving time and resources. Additionally, it improves consistency and reliability in your environments, ensuring that your infrastructure is always in the desired state. Mastering Ansible can also boost your career prospects, as automation skills are highly valued in the IT industry.